Activity Outline
Sydwest Eye Specialists are proud to provide an educational evening for optometrists. Drs. Nancy Younan, James Chau-Vo and Simon Nothling will present on a variety topics including:
Anterior Uveitis
Is low tension glaucoma the diagnosis?
OCT interpretation in retina diseases
Learning Objectives
- Recognise signs of anterior uveitis and refer to ophthalmologist
- Be aware of sight threatening complications of anterior uveitis.
- Be able to differentiate between low tension glaucoma and other causes of optic neuropathy
- Be aware of systemic associations with low tension glaucoma progression
- Understand the anatomy of the macula on OCT scan
- Understand the OCT changes in various macula diseases
